Travel Retail Experts to present Lamy 2000 Stainless Steel in Cannes

The Lamy 2000 now comes in stainless steel with a matt brushed finish

Travel Retail Experts will unveil a polished stainless steel version of Lamy’s classic 2000 series, alongside other creations in the Lamy collection, at the TFWA World Exhibition next week (Stand number: Red Village M27).

As reported, Travel Retail Experts has been appointed by the German writing instruments company as its travel retail agent worldwide (except Scandinavia).

The original Lamy 2000 fountain pen, designed by Gerd A. Müller in 1966, has been a design classic for over 40 years and is today on permanent display at the Museum of Modern Art in New York, according to Travel Retail Experts.

The Lamy 2000 was designed as a high-precision handwriting tool crafted using a combination of polycarbonate and stainless steel in a procedure which was said to be unique to Lamy.

For the first time, Lamy now presents the Lamy 2000 series in a stainless steel version with a matt brushed finish which is polished by hand.

The Lamy 2000 Stainless Steel is offered in three styles: a high-end fountain pen with platinum coated 14 ct gold nib and piston mechanism; a ballpoint pen with push mechanism; and a rollerball pen.

About Lamy

Lamy is an independent family-owned enterprise which was established in 1930 by C. Josef Lamy in Heidelberg. The company, said to be a market leader in Germany, has an annual production of approximately seven million writing instruments and a turnover exceeding €50 million.
